Emergency Leak Stop Tools. Remembering as a plumber how water leaks caused so much damage, and how difficult it was to react quickly controlling a leak if a copper fitting hadn't completely soldered. The time it took to attach a hose pipe and drain the pipe work, took too long, and the damage was already done. After checking what products were available in the market place, we confirmed there was a lack of easy-quick to use products that covered various pipe sizes 10, 15 and 22 mm (3/8, 1/2, 3/4 inch) that was reusable for all Tradesmen and DIY enthusiasts. We designed a product that anyone can use quickly and simply, that seals leaking pipes or soldered fittings in seconds, you don't need any other tools to fit one and it can be used over and over again. It is with pleasure that we Introduce you to Leak Mate a Unique product launched in June 2011 that has been received with great enthusiasm via the Professional and Domestic market throughout the UK, Leak Mate is the only reusable Tool specifically designed to stop leaks in seconds, saving inconvenience, expensive call out charges and Insurance claims. The tool is supplied with reusable 10 15 and 22 mm (3/8, 1/2, 3/4 inch) seals that have a recessed step molded into every seal to fit soldered copper fittings. Leak Mate also seals split and holed pipes whether plastic, copper or lead. leak-mate-wins-top-product-2011-327In 2011 Leak Mate was given a top product award by PHPI, Designed to meet the needs of tradesmen involved with plumbing installation. Didn't work for me, but might work for most
First of all, this is MISLABELED as of this date - the product information says it is for 3/8, 1/2, and 1/4" fittings; it should state "and 3/4" (if you click on the image that shows the reverse of the package and zoom in you'll see that this is exactly what it says on the package, it's the Amazon description that is wrong). Also be aware that when they say 1/2" they mean a pipe that is not at all 1/2", it's another one of those crazy "National Pipe" dimensions, so measure your pipe and Google "National Pipe OD" to make sure you really have a 3/8 or a 1/2 or a 3/4 pipe. Yeah, it drives me crazy, too.Anyway, my situation was that I had a pipe fitted into a union that had never been soldered, and it had rusted internally so much that I couldn't get a good solder joint. Unfortunately that left me with a pipe with a bit of solder adhered to the bottom, ruining its perfectly circular profile; and the LeakMate needs a perfect circle. To be specific, the clamp comes with several rubber sleeve inserts to adopt it to different pipe sizes, and these sleeves have a small step-down to match the corresponding pipe union. This step-down has to fit over the place where the pipe enters the union EXACTLY (at least on the 3/4", which being the largest has the least amount of rubber; the sleeves for the smaller pipe sizes have a lot more rubber so they might be more forgiving). So all I accomplished was to slow, but not stop, the leak, which I finally fixed using the excellent Rectorseal pipe repair kit (also from Amazon - do a search).Nonetheless, I am keeping the LeakMate because I can see that it might be a lifesaver some day. You should not consider the LeakMate as in any way a permanent fix but rather something to "mostly" fix a problem pending a permanent solution. I have to subtract a star because it is, as of this date, mislabeled; and another star because it did not work for me (and my situation is surely not unique). But as something to have in your toolbox for a rainy day - or at least a leaky day - it seems like a good thing to have.

Definitely nicer than my hose clamp piece of rubber option. Like others have mentioned will not work well on any run that is tight to another surface, which is how the majority of pipes will be run.

Didn't work on my copper pipe & coupling leak. LeakMate didn't come with a correct size rubber insert for my problem. I'm sure it would work on copper pipe alone without a coupling.

Did not work for a leak at a hub. Ended up cutting out the tee and fixing with Sharkbite slip couplings and tee. Expensive for a maybe.
